Investment thesis

CareQuest Innovation Partners addresses a critical gap in oral health innovation and funding. The firm recognizes that oral health is underserved in venture capital, with digital dental health startups receiving less than 2% of digital health funding despite the $54 billion oral health prevention market. The firm focuses on transforming oral health and overall health outcomes by funding solutions in teledentistry, medical-dental integration, pediatric care, and maternal health. Operating as a for-profit arm of a national nonprofit focused on health care accessibility and equity, the firm combines commercial investment with mission-driven impact.

CareQuest Innovation Partners has been advancing medical-dental integration and preventive oral health initiatives through its SMILE Health accelerator and ACCELERATE program, with recent wins including a pilot demonstrating significant increases in early childhood dental visits. AI summary
